How many atoms are in 9.44 moles of Al?

Answer:

c) %5.68×10²⁴

Step-by-step explanation:

Number atoms=Avogadro's number ₓ number of moles

N= 6.023ₓ 10²³×9.44

N=5.68×10²⁴
